Michael Pawlowski

You are here: Obituaries / Michael Pawlowski
June 21, 1956 - April 2, 2022
Pawlowski Obit Photo

It is with profound sadness that the family of Michael Pawlowski announce he has blown this popsicle stand at the age of 65 years. He will be lovingly remembered by his wife of 34 years, Gerry; daughters, Alicia (John), and Madeleine; his siblings, Adrian (Janet), Dennis (Loreen), Eileen (Carl), Maria (Julian), Laurie (John), Kathleen (Philip); and numerous nephews, nieces, and cousins. He was predeceased by his parents, Irene and Frank.

Michael was a wonderful dad, loving husband, son, brother, uncle and friend to so many. After an exciting early career at Transport/Nav Canada that provided countless nail biting and hilarious cowboy stories, Michael changed gears working in IT as a network engineer at both Bell and Telus. Michael cherished the lifelong friendships he made with his colleagues who long suffered his comedic stylings.

There was nothing Michael couldn’t do, make or invent, his family will have to get used to paying professionals now. An exceptional athlete at all things but his biggest love: golf, a lover of the outdoors and adventure, we imagine he’s ‘Gone fishing’ permanently.

At Michael’s request no service will be held; ice cream party to celebrate the man “who never met an ice cream he didn’t like” to be held at a later date.

Michael’s girls love flowers, but donations to Brain Cancer Canada are recommended.
